Jerry F Mcfadden 1939 - 2005

Jerry F McFadden of Lenexa, Johnson County, KS was born on June 2, 1939, and died at age 66 years old on August 3, 2005. Jerry McFadden was buried at Leavenworth National Cemetery Section 53-A Row 30 Site 6 150 Muncie Road, in Leavenworth.

In 1939, in the year that Jerry F Mcfadden was born, on the 1st of September, Nazi Germany invaded Poland. On September 17th, the Soviet Union invaded Poland as well. Poland expected help from France and the United Kingdom, since they had a pact with both. But no help came. By October 6th, the Soviet Union and Nazi Germany held full control of the previously Polish lands. Eventually, the invasion of Poland lead to World War II.

In 1946, at the age of just 7 years old, Jerry was alive when pediatrician Dr. Benjamin Spock's book "The Common Sense Book of Baby and Child Care" was published. It sold half a million copies in the first six months. Aside from the Bible, it became the best selling book of the 20th century. A generation of Baby Boomers were raised by the advice of Dr. Spock.
